Package        : ansible
CVE ID         : CVE-2019-10156 CVE-2019-10206 CVE-2019-14846 CVE-2019-14864 
                 CVE-2019-14904 CVE-2020-1733  CVE-2020-1735  CVE-2020-1739 
                 CVE-2020-1740  CVE-2020-1746  CVE-2020-1753  CVE-2020-10684 
                 CVE-2020-10685 CVE-2020-10729 CVE-2020-14330 CVE-2020-14332 
                 CVE-2020-14365 CVE-2021-20228

Several vulnerabilities have been found in Ansible, a configuration
management, deployment and task execution system, which could result in
information disclosure or argument injection. In addition a race
condition in become_user was fixed. 

For the stable distribution (buster), these problems have been fixed in
version 2.7.7+dfsg-1+deb10u1.

We recommend that you upgrade your ansible packages.
